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from St Helier (London) to Three Oaks start from £40.00 one way, or £40.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from St Helier (London) to Three Oaks are available for £43.70 one way, or £43.80 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

While St Helier station prides itself on having a working blend of modern services in a community-friendly environment, it offers basic yet essential amenities. It does not contain a formal ticket office, yet you can easily purchase or collect your tickets via the automated machines available. These machines are accessible and cater to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, keeping accessibility at the forefront.

St Helier might not boast luxurious amenities; there are no toilets, baby changing facilities, waiting rooms, or refreshment stands. However, seating is available should you need to rest before your journey. For those on two wheels, the station caters with 30 bicycle storage spaces that are secure and CCTV-monitored. Despite its modest offerings, the presence of its accessible ticket machines and induction loops makes it a commendable choice for efficient travel.

Facilities and Amenities at Three Oaks

While Three Oaks train station lacks a ticket office, it does offer a ticket machine from which you can easily collect tickets bought online. The absence of staff at the station is mitigated by accessible help points and ample signage, ensuring travelers can navigate their way effectively. For those with accessibility concerns, the station is partly step-free. Steep ramps provide access to platforms, and there's the added provision of ramp assistance for train access, though it must be pre-arranged as station staff is not present.

Cyclists will find a limited number of bike racks available. However, amenities such as refreshments, toilets, and waiting rooms are notably absent. This makes it a functional but minimalistic stop, prioritizing transit over creature comforts. Additionally, smart card usage is available at the station through validators, even though smartcards cannot be issued here directly.
